Luke Coffey discusses the current state of the war in Ukraine, the fight brewing in Congress over additional US military aid, and the course of the war as it enters its second year on the Vandenberg Coalition鈥檚 podcast Flash Focus.

Caption
The logo of Japan's largest steel manufacturer Nippon Steel corporation is seen in front of the company's head office in Tokyo on January 7, 2025. (David Marueil/ via Getty Images)